The fate of the Yasuní will be known today

Posted On 15 Aug 2013

Today, the President of Ecuador, Rafael Correa, will inform to Ecuadorians the decision to be taken on the Yasuní-ITT initiative after several analyses made at the meetings carried out in recent days.

At the begining,  the plan was to keep underground 846 million barrels of crude oil, located in the bowels of the Ishpingo, Tambococha and Tiputini fields in Exchange for foreign countries to support the initiative financially.

After yesterday’s meeting, which lasted more than 3 hours,   Ecuadorian Foreign Minister Ricardo Patiño, indicated that  he was not authorized, as well as any other authority, to announce the decision on the Yasuni-ITT initiative, and that President himself will be the one to communicate the decision in a national primetime television broadcast today.
